During a show held on Wednesday night (16), the singer Rita Ora, 33, was moved when singing his partnership with Liam Payne . On the last day, fans and celebrities mourned the death of the former band member One Direction .
Rita and Liam released the song “For You” for the film “50 Shades Freed” in 2018. During the show, the singer was unable to sing part of the song and asked fans to complete the song. “I can’t do this right now.”

On social media, the singer published a tribute to her colleague.
“I am devastated. He had the kindest soul, I will never forget it. I loved working with him so much, he was a joy to be around on and off the stage. This tragic news breaks my heart. Sending all my love and prayers to your family and loved ones. Our song ‘For You’ takes on a whole new meaning for me now,” the artist wrote in a post filled with photos of the two.
Liam Payne died after falling from the balcony of a hotel in Buenos Aires, Argentina on Wednesday (16). The police are still investigating the possible causes of death.
